## Ticket #— Locked Vault Blocking Pagination Fix — Lattermile API

The cursor-pagination hotfix for the Lattermile public REST API is ready, but deployment credentials live in the Coveridge vault, which locked itself after three failed unseal attempts overnight. On-call: please unseal it carefully — a fourth failure triggers a 12-hour lockout and the pagination bug will keep returning duplicate pages. The unseal passphrase for tonight's rotation is:

vault phrase of fawif-haduf = wenwyn-briath

Subject: Partner SFTP drop — new owner

Hi,

As you review the pending changes to the Harborline ingest scripts, note that ownership of the partner SFTP drop is changing at the end of the month. This includes key rotation, the nightly pull job, and the quarantine folder for malformed files. Review comments on the retry logic should still go through the normal PR flow, but questions about drop-folder conventions or partner onboarding now go to the new owner. The incoming owner is listed below.

signatory, tagaf-bahaf: Praael Fenmir Rusok

Handover for Shelfwright catalogue import: the Tuesday batch from the Marrowgate branch failed validation twice — duplicate accession numbers, not corruption. I've quarantined the affected records; re-run the import after the dedupe script finishes. Nothing else is pending. If the third run fails, follow the escalation steps documented on the page below.

runbook for badug-kadup: https://confluence.zemvarlabs.internal/projects/browse/display/projects/bd1b